Arlesey is a semi-rural town situated in the north of Bedfordshire, nestled close to the Hertfordshire border. With its origins dating back to the Domesday Book, Arlesey has developed from a medieval village with strong agricultural roots, to a well-connected commuter town while still retaining its tranquil charm. Its setting along the River Hiz and proximity to open countryside appeal to those seeking a quieter pace of life, yet with easy access to urban amenities.
